    Guardians recalled OF Petey Halpin from Triple-A Columbus

    Halpin has gone 9-for-53 (.170) in 56 plate appearances for the Guardians this season with a 16/1 K/BB ratio. He will just be a bench outfielder for the time being.

    The Marlins are discussing Kyle Stowers along with Liam Hicks in trade talks, according to The Athletic.

    The story from Ken Rosenthal and Will Sammon suggests that Stowers and Hicks are more likely that Otto Lopez or Xavier Edwards to get traded prior to Monday’s deadline. With his strikeout rate up to 32 percent, Stowers is hitting .237/.322/.465 this season, a big drop from last year’s .288/.368/.544 line. Still, he generates excellent bat speed with a rather short swing, and he’s currently making the minimum while not being eligible for free agency until after 2029.

    Emmanuel Rodriguez is out of High-A Cedar Rapids’ lineup on Sunday because of thumb soreness.

    Rodriguez was in the original lineup and then scratched, with led to some trade speculation, but his absence is due to issues with the left thumb he had surgery on back in May. Today’s game was supposed to be the fifth on his rehab assignment before rejoining Triple-A St. Paul.

    Giants transferred LHP Matt Gage to the 60-day injured list.

    Nothing has changed in the prognosis for the 33-year-old southpaw, who is currently shelved with a moderate flexor tendon strain, this was done as a procedural move to free up a spot on the Giants’ 40-man roster for the addition of Buddy Kennedy on Sunday. The Giants have yet to provide a clear timeline for Gage’s return.

    Joel Sherman of the New York Post reports that the Yankees are in discussions to acquire infielder Luis García Jr. from the Nationals.

    García was scratched from the Nationals’ lineup on Sunday, presumably as the two sides were getting deeper into discussions. Sherman also notes that Yankees’ Double-A starter Jack Cebert has been included prominently in those discussions. Stay tuned, as when there’s this much smoke, there’s usually fire.

    Andrés Chaparro was removed from Sunday’s game against the Braves after being hit in the head by a pitch.

    Chaparro was hit by the pitch with the bases loaded in the fourth inning, bringing in the Nationals’ first run. He remained in the game to run the bases for himself and manned his position in the field during the home half of the fourth inning but was ultimately replaced when the Nats took the field in the fifth. He’ll likely have to pass through the concussion protocol before he’s cleared to return.

    Blue Jays acquired RHP Jameson Taillon from the Cubs for cash considerations or a player to be named later.

    The Cubs designated the veteran right-hander for assignment earlier in the week, so they were willing to flip him for anything that they could get at this stage. The 34-year-old hurler holds a miserable 5.92 ERA across 76 innings in his 15 starts this season. It’s unclear if he’ll get an opportunity to pitch out of the rotation for the Blue Jays or if he’ll be utilized out of the bullpen initially instead.
